//go:build linux
// +build linux
package netavark_test
import (
"fmt"
"net"
"os"
"reflect"
"testing"
"github.com/containers/common/libnetwork/netavark"
"github.com/containers/common/libnetwork/types"
"github.com/containers/common/libnetwork/util"
. "github.com/onsi/ginkgo/v2"
. "github.com/onsi/gomega"
gomegaTypes "github.com/onsi/gomega/types"
)
func TestNetavark(t *testing.T) {
RegisterFailHandler(Fail)
RunSpecs(t, "Netavark Suite")
}
var netavarkBinary string
func init() {
netavarkBinary = os.Getenv("NETAVARK_BINARY")
if netavarkBinary == "" {
netavarkBinary = "/usr/libexec/podman/netavark"
}
}
func getNetworkInterface(confDir string) (types.ContainerNetwork, error) {
return netavark.NewNetworkInterface(&netavark.InitConfig{
NetworkConfigDir: confDir,
NetavarkBinary: netavarkBinary,
NetworkRunDir: confDir,
})
}
// EqualSubnet is a custom GomegaMatcher to match a subnet
// This makes sure to not use the 16 bytes ip representation.
func EqualSubnet(subnet *net.IPNet) gomegaTypes.GomegaMatcher {
return &equalSubnetMatcher{
expected: subnet,
}
}
type equalSubnetMatcher struct {
expected *net.IPNet
}
func (m *equalSubnetMatcher) Match(actual interface{}) (bool, error) {
util.NormalizeIP(&m.expected.IP)
subnet, ok := actual.(*net.IPNet)
if !ok {
return false, fmt.Errorf("EqualSubnet expects a *net.IPNet")
}
util.NormalizeIP(&subnet.IP)
return reflect.DeepEqual(subnet, m.expected), nil
}
func (m *equalSubnetMatcher) FailureMessage(actual interface{}) string {
return fmt.Sprintf("Expected subnet %#v to equal subnet %#v", actual, m.expected)
}
func (m *equalSubnetMatcher) NegatedFailureMessage(actual interface{}) string {
return fmt.Sprintf("Expected subnet %#v not to equal subnet %#v", actual, m.expected)
}
